What is technology?
      
      Technology is more than a hardware.
         Technology is the applied side of scientific 
           development. 


It is the collection of tools, including machinery, modifications, arrangements and procedures used by humans. Technologies significantly affect human as well as other animal species' ability to control and adapt to their natural environments. The term can either be applied generally or to specific areas: examples include construction technology, medical technology and information technology. - Wikipedia


Educational Technology

What is Educational Technology?

It is a field study which is concerned with the practice of using educational methods and resources for the ultimate goal of facilitating the learning process. (Lucido & Borabo, 1997)
             It is a complex, integrated process involving people, procedures, ideas, devices, and organization for analyzing problems and devising, implementing, evaluating, and managing solutions to those problems involved in all aspects of human learning. (Corpuz & Lucido, 2008)


Other terms associated with educational technology:

  • technology in education,
  • instructional technology,
  • technology integration, and 
  • educational media  


Technology in Education
  • The application of technology to any of those processes involved in operating the institutions which house the educational enterprise. (Jonassen, 1999)

Instructional Technology
  • The tools used in teaching and learning.
  • It refers to those aspects of educational technology that are concerned with instruction. It is a systematic way of designing, carrying out, and evaluating the total process of learning and teaching in terms of specific objectives. (Lucido & Borabo, 1997)
Technology Integration
  • It means using learning technologies to introduce, reinforce, supplement, and extend skills (Williams, 2000)
Educational Media
  • The channels or instruments of communications which serves educational purposes (Lucido & Paz, 2008)
